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Huntington North High School (Huntington, IN)
Huntington North High School is situated on the southeast side of Huntington, Indiana, a city nestled within Huntington County. The school benefits from its location within a community that balances suburban residential areas with access to local businesses and green spaces. Major access routes include U.S. Route 14 (E. State Street) and State Road 5 (North Jefferson Street), which provide connections to the wider state highway system. Parking is primarily available on school grounds, with dedicated lots for events, though street parking near residential areas can also be an option during less busy periods. The nearest significant airport is Fort Wayne International Airport (FWA), located approximately 30-40 miles east of Huntington, requiring a car ride of about 45-60 minutes depending on traffic. Public transportation within Huntington is limited, making personal vehicles or rideshare services the most practical options for getting around. Smart arrival tactics for school events often involve factoring in school dismissal traffic if your event coincides, and allowing extra time for parking and entry, especially for larger athletic contests.

Weather & Seasons at Huntington North High School
- Winter: Winter in Huntington brings cold temperatures, with daytime highs often in the 30s and nighttime lows dipping into the teens. Visitors should pack heavy coats, hats, gloves, and waterproof footwear. Outdoor events can be challenging due to the chill, so warm-up layers are essential for spectators and participants. Travel to and from the school might require extra caution if roads are icy or snowy.
- Spring & early summer: Spring and early summer offer increasingly mild and pleasant weather, with temperatures ranging from the 50s to the 70s. This is an ideal time for outdoor sporting events. Light jackets or sweaters are useful for cooler mornings and evenings, while lighter clothing suffices during the day. Be prepared for occasional rain showers, so a compact umbrella or rain jacket is a wise addition to your packing list.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er typically brings warm to hot and humid conditions, with temperatures often climbing into the 80s and 90s. Hydration is key, so encourage teams and spectators to drink plenty of water. Lightweight, breathable clothing is recommended. Outdoor events might feel more strenuous in the heat, so seeking shade or planning activities for cooler parts of the day can be beneficial.
- Fall season: Fall is characterized by crisp air and comfortable temperatures, generally ranging from the 50s to the 70s. This season is perfect for outdoor athletic events like football and cross-country. Layers are your best friend; pack sweaters, long-sleeved shirts, and a medium-weight jacket for warmth. The vibrant autumn foliage also makes for scenic drives and walks around the community.
- Rain & snow: Rain is possible throughout the year in Huntington, though more frequent in spring and fall. Winter can bring snow, sometimes light flurries and occasionally heavier accumulations that can impact travel and outdoor activities. Always check local weather forecasts before heading to events and be prepared with appropriate outerwear and footwear for wet or snowy conditions. Indoor venues and nearby dining options offer good alternatives during inclement weather.
